Introduction

In today’s fast-paced business environment, managing employee travel expenses efficiently is essential for maintaining financial accuracy and operational effectiveness. With the complexities of capturing receipts, submitting expense reports, and ensuring timely approvals, organizations need a streamlined solution. Dynamics 365 Project Operation provides powerful Expense Management capabilities that simplify the entire travel expense lifecycle. In this article, we will delve into the key configurations required for capturing receipts through the mobile app, submitting expense reports from mobile app for workflow approval, and ensuring accurate financial postings to the correct main accounts.


The Importance of Managing Business Travel Expenses

  1. Cost Control: Effective tracking of travel expenses helps organizations monitor budgets and avoid overspending.
  2. Compliance: A structured system ensures that all expenses comply with company policies and regulations.
  3. Efficiency: Automating the approval process and receipt management saves time for both employees and finance teams.
  4. Employee Satisfaction: A user-friendly interface encourages employees to submit expenses promptly and accurately.

Step-by-Step Configuration for Employee Business Travel

Step 1: Create Main Accounts

  • Go to General Ledger > Chart of Accounts > Main Accounts.
  • Click on New to create accounts specifically for travel expenses:

Step 2: Configure Expense Categories

  • Go to Travel and Expense Management > Setup > General > Expense categories.
  • Create Flight Expense Category

Step 9: Process Supplier Payments

  • Create payment journal and run payment proposal
  • Select open expenses invoices
  • Post payment journal
  • Update expense payment information: Expense management > Periodic tasks > Update expense payment information
  • Payment voucher get printed on expense report screen
